I am a Home Support Worker applicant, currently completing the 12 months work experience requirement in Ontario. I would need clarification on when I can complete the work hours per requirement,

I work 6.5hours per day Monday to Friday since July 1, 2023 without any absences. I do not work during Legal Holidays and is not paid on these holidays too if they fall on a weekday.

I worry about the clause that defines the worked hours.
  • be full-time authorized work in Canada
  • Full-time means at least 30 hours of paid work each week.
  • Any week where you worked less than 30 hours doesn’t count

So in a normal work week, I do 32.5 hours. However, if there is one holiday within a week, I am only being paid for 26.0 hours. How do I then compute if I am already qualified to submit for the "12 months work experience". Do I literally sum the number of work hours (then 1,560 hours) ? Do I literally count 52 weeks of 30+ hours work weeks (which means drop all the weeks where there is holiday) ? Or can I simply submit work experience from July 1, 2023 up to June 30, 2024?
